What is the procedure for filing a complaint for cheque bounce?

The procedure for filing a complaint for cheque bounce is as follows: Issue a Demand Notice: The first step is to issue a demand notice to the drawer of the cheque within 30 days of the cheque bounce, demanding payment of the amount due. The demand notice must be sent through registered post with acknowledgement due or by courier, email, or any other electronic mode. The demand notice should include details such as the cheque number, date of issue, amount, reason for bouncing, and a demand for payment within 15 days of receipt of the notice. Wait for Payment: If the drawer makes the payment within 15 days of receiving the demand notice, the matter is settled, and no further action is required. File a Complaint: If the drawer fails to make the payment within 15 days of receiving the demand notice, the payee can file a complaint before the appropriate court within 30 days of the expiry of the notice period. The complaint must be filed in the court having jurisdiction over the place where the cheque was dishonored or where the drawer resides. Submit Supporting Documents: The payee must submit supporting documents along with the complaint, including the original cheque, the dishonored memo issued by the bank, the demand notice, and any other relevant documents. Court Proceedings: The court will then issue a summons to the drawer of the cheque, requiring them to appear before the court and answer the complaint. If the drawer fails to appear in court, the court may issue a non-bailable warrant for their arrest. If the drawer is found guilty, the court may impose a fine and/or imprisonment as per the provisions of Section 138 of the Negotiable Instruments Act. It is important to note that the procedure for filing a complaint for cheque bounce may vary slightly depending on the specific facts and circumstances of each case. It is advisable to seek the assistance of a legal professional to ensure compliance with all the necessary legal requirements.
